What this inspection record means

OSHA opens inspections for many reasons — routine scheduling under a national or local emphasis program, an employee complaint or referral, or a follow-up after a reported injury. Opening or conducting an inspection is not itself an allegation or a finding that this employer broke any rule; any findings appear as the citations listed below, and citations can be contested, reduced, or withdrawn.

29 CFR 1926.451(c)(2)(v): The employer used forklifts  to support scaffold platforms without ensuring that the entire platform was attached to the fork:    a) 95 Hornbean Ave., Woolwich, NJ: On or about Feb 27, 2019 a REF Construction Inc employee was working from a plywood scaffold platform rested on the forks of a Pettibone Rough Terrain Fork Lift.  The platform was not secured to the forks, exposing the employee to a fall hazard of over 20 feet to the ground below.

29 CFR 1926.451(g)(1): Each employee on a scaffold more than 10 feet above a lower level were not protected from falling to that lower level.  a) 95 Hornbean Ave., Woolwich, NJ: On or about Feb 27, 2019 a REF Construction Inc employee was working from a plywood scaffold platform rested on the forks of a Pettibone Rough Terrain Fork Lift.  There was no guard rail, fall restraint, or personal fall arrest system in use, exposing the employee to a fall hazard of over 20 feet to the ground below.
